تحميل برنامج SonarQube Data Center Edition لتحليل الأكواد البرمجية
“استثمر في جودة كودك مع SonarQube Data Center Edition” هل تعبت من البحث عن الأخطاء في الكود؟ هل تريد ضمان جودة عالية وكفاءة في مشاريعك البرمجية؟ SonarQube Data Center Edition هو الحل الأمثل لك!

تحميل برنامج SonarQube Data Center Edition | لتحليل الأكواد البرمجية

SonarQube Data Center Edition هو أداة قوية لتحليل الكود الثابت، صُممت لمساعدة الفرق في تحسين جودة الكود وأمنه. يوفر لك هذا الحل الشامل مجموعة واسعة من الميزات التي تساعدك على:

  • كشف الثغرات الأمنية: يكتشف SonarQube بسهولة الثغرات الأمنية الشائعة في الكود، مما يساعدك على حماية تطبيقك من الهجمات.
  • تحسين قابلية الصيانة: يقوم بتحليل الكود ويحدد المناطق التي تحتاج إلى إعادة هيكلة، مما يجعل الكود أسهل في الفهم والتعديل.
  • زيادة الإنتاجية: يساعد SonarQube الفرق على كتابة كود أفضل من البداية، مما يقلل من الوقت والجهد اللازمين لإصلاح الأخطاء.
  • التوافق مع معايير الصناعة: يدعم SonarQube مجموعة واسعة من لغات البرمجة ومعايير التشفير، مما يضمن أن الكود الخاص بك يلبي أعلى المعايير.
  • التكامل مع أدوات DevOps: يمكن دمج SonarQube بسهولة في سير عمل DevOps الخاص بك، مما يتيح لك أتمتة عمليات تحليل الكود.

تحميل برنامج SonarQube Data Center Edition لتحليل الأكواد البرمجية

أهم المميزات:

  • تحليل شامل: يقوم بتحليل الكود بحثًا عن مجموعة واسعة من المشاكل، بما في ذلك الأخطاء، والروائح الكودية، والثغرات الأمنية، والمخالفات للمعايير.
  • تقارير مفصلة: يوفر تقارير مفصلة وسهلة الفهم حول حالة جودة الكود، مما يساعدك على تحديد المناطق التي تحتاج إلى تحسين.
  • تخصيص القواعد: يمكنك تخصيص القواعد لتحليل الكود وفقًا لاحتياجات مشروعك.
  • دعم متعدد اللغات: يدعم مجموعة واسعة من لغات البرمجة، بما في ذلك Java، وC#، وC++، وPython، وغيرها الكثير.
  • قابلة للتوسع: يمكنك توسيع SonarQube لتلبية احتياجات فريقك المتنامي.

استخدامات SonarQube Data Center Edition:

  • فرق تطوير البرمجيات: لتحسين جودة الكود وأمنه.
  • شركات البرمجيات: لضمان جودة منتجاتها.
  • المنظمات الحكومية: لتأمين أنظمتها المعلوماتية.

لماذا تختار SonarQube Data Center Edition؟

  • موثوقية: يعتمد عليه آلاف الشركات حول العالم.
  • سهولة الاستخدام: واجهة مستخدم بديهية وسهلة الاستخدام.
  • دعم ممتاز: فريق دعم متاح لمساعدتك في أي وقت.

تحميل موفق للجميع

انتهى الموضوع

تابع أحدث و أفضل البرامج من قسم البرامج من هنا

كما يمكنك متابعتنا على صفحة فارس الاسطوانات على الفيسبوك

ويمكنك الإنضمام لجروب فارس الإسطوانات على الفيسبوك .

مع تحيات موقع فارس الاسطوانات.

أسئلة وأجوبة حول برنامج SonarQube Data Center Edition

SonarQube Data Center Edition هو أداة قوية لتحليل جودة الكود على نطاق واسع. يقدم تحليلاً عميقاً للكود المصدر للكشف عن الثغرات الأمنية، الأخطاء الشائعة، وانتهاكات القواعد البرمجية. وهو مصمم خصيصًا للفرق الكبيرة والشركات التي تحتاج إلى تحليل كميات كبيرة من الكود.

  • تحليل عميق للكود: يكشف عن مجموعة واسعة من المشاكل في الكود، بدءًا من الأخطاء النحوية وحتى الثغرات الأمنية المعقدة.
  • دعم لغات برمجة متعددة: يدعم مجموعة واسعة من لغات البرمجة الشائعة، مما يجعله مناسبًا لمجموعة متنوعة من المشاريع.
  • تكامل سلس مع أدوات التطوير: يتكامل بسهولة مع أدوات التطوير الشائعة مثل Git وJenkins، مما يسهل دمجه في سير العمل الحالي.
  • تقارير مفصلة: يوفر تقارير مفصلة حول جودة الكود، مما يساعد الفرق على تحديد المجالات التي تحتاج إلى تحسين.
  • قابلية التوسعة: يمكن تخصيصه ليناسب احتياجات المشروع المحدد.
  • أداء عالي: مصمم لتحليل كميات كبيرة من الكود بسرعة وكفاءة.
  • تحسين جودة الكود: يساعد في الكشف عن الأخطاء والثغرات الأمنية في وقت مبكر، مما يقلل من تكلفة الإصلاح.
  • زيادة إنتاجية المطورين: من خلال توفير أدوات لتحليل الكود وتحديد المشاكل بسرعة.
  • تقليل المخاطر الأمنية: يساعد في حماية التطبيقات من الهجمات عن طريق الكشف عن الثغرات الأمنية.
  • تحسين سمعة الشركة: من خلال تقديم منتجات عالية الجودة.
  • المطورون: يساعد المطورين في كتابة كود نظيف وآمن.
  • مدراء المشاريع: يساعد مدراء المشاريع في تتبع تقدم المشروع وضمان جودة المنتج النهائي.
  • فرق ضمان الجودة: يساعد فرق ضمان الجودة في تحديد الأخطاء والثغرات الأمنية في التطبيقات.
  • الشركات التي تهتم بجودة البرمجيات: تساعد الشركات على تحقيق أهدافها في مجال الجودة والكفاءة.
  1. التثبيت: قم بتثبيت SonarQube على الخادم الخاص بك.
  2. التكوين: قم بتكوين SonarQube لتناسب احتياجات مشروعك.
  3. التكامل: قم بتكامل SonarQube مع أدوات التطوير الحالية.
  4. التحليل: قم بتحليل الكود الخاص بك باستخدام SonarQube.
  5. التحسين: قم بتحديد المشاكل وإصلاحها لتحسين جودة الكود.
  • تعلم الأداة: قد يستغرق الأمر بعض الوقت لتعلم كيفية استخدام SonarQube بشكل فعال.
  • تكلفة الترخيص: قد تكون تكلفة الترخيص مرتفعة للشركات الصغيرة.
  • تكامل الأنظمة: قد يكون هناك بعض التحديات في تكامل SonarQube مع الأنظمة الموجودة.

نعم، هناك العديد من البدائل لـ SonarQube، مثل:

  • SonarCloud: وهو نسخة سحابية من SonarQube.
  • Code Climate: أداة أخرى لتحليل جودة الكود.
  • Coverity: أداة لتحليل الأمان.

الاختيار بين هذه الأدوات يعتمد على احتياجاتك المحددة وميزانيتك.

روابط التحميل

ForaFile (مميز وسريع)

Filespayout

Upload-4ever

يهمك أيضًا

Scroll to Top